Precious Kitten likely to purr in Hollywood Park’s Gamely
Monday’s nine-furlong Grade 1 Gamely (race 3) attracted just five fillies and mares, including win machine Rutherienne. The 9-for-11 late running miss has never earned a triple digit speed fig, but she has a nose for the wire and will be finishing once again. However, she will not get much pace to chase in this compact field.
Precious Kitten is the one to beat at 6-5 on the line. She lost ground from an outer post in a needed effort behind the aforementioned Rutherienne at Keenland last time. She has more speed than she showed in her latest and is a Grade 1 winner at this distance. Expect aggressive handling from Bejarano.
Diamond Diva is 2-2 at a flat mile in this country, and we will see how she fares at this longer trip against tougher. Her early/pressing speed should play well in this spot, and she sports a Santa Anita bullet (6f, 1:11) for this engagement. This is not a great betting race, but she looks like the value play at 4-1…and the only pace threat to Precious Kitten.
Lavender Sky was not at her best at Santa Anita last out, but her rally is frequently good for a share. Sustained runner Solva rounds out the field.
